Parliamentary Committee on Labour Hearings Continue

The Parliamentary Committee on Labour continued our hearings, to ensure help, support and assistance to all workers who are facing difficulties due to COVID-19 pandemic. Today the Ministry of Consumer Affairs, Food and Public Distribution and the Ministry of Housing and Urban Affairs gave us an update on what their respective ministries have been doing.
So far, our Government has provided free of cost foodgrain to over 81 crore beneficieries under the Pradhan Mantri Garib Kalyan Anna Yojana. This is over and above the regular ration distributed through NFSA. For migrant workers, free of cost food grains were provide to all under the Atma Nirbhar Bharat Scheme.
We were also informed that the Union Government will be working towards provisioning low cost housing to migrant workers under the Affordable Rental Housing Complexes (ARHCs).
I have highlighted irregularities in distribution of ration in Darjeeling hills, Terai and Dooars, particularly in the tea gardens. I also highlighted how returning migrant workers from our region did not get their free of cost ration as allocated by the Central Govt.
I also informed the Committee on the delay in provisioning digital ration card, which has lead to many people from our region in being depriped of their right to food.
I have therefore requested the Ministry of Consumer Affairs, Food and Public Distribution to conduct an indepth inquiry into these issues, so that those who have tried to deprive people from our region in such difficult times can be exposed and punished.
